Maharashtra is set to go to polls on October 21, 2019, News Nation brings a special show 'Chunavi Bhau', gauging the mood of voters in the state. In today’s segment of the show, our team reached Amravati. The district sends 8 MLAs to state assembly. In the last elections, people of Avravai were promised of textile units, Orange process unit and making the region malnutrition-free. Watch what the voters think about upcoming elections.
